Against the wind…
After enjoying a day off, PAOK players returned to training on Wednesday, focusing on Sunday’s encounter against Levadiakos.
Giorgos Georgiadis and his players trained at Nea Mesimvria on Wednesday afternoon, but high winds obstructed their movements and constantly changed the trajectory of the ball.
In the first part of the session, players engaged in aerobic adjustments and stability drills under the guidance of physical condition trainer Dimitris Daniilidis. Afterwards it was all about tactics, with exercises and games against four goals.
Only Dimitris Salpingidis is still on the medical report of PAOK, the Greek forward following a special rehabilitation program following his left foot surgery. Răzvan Raț and Dimitris Papadopoulos return to action in the game against Levadiakos having served their suspension, but Georgiadis cannot count on Miguel Vítor and Stefanos Athanasiadis, also suspended.
PAOK players will train at Nea Mesimvria on Thursday, their session kicking off at 12.00.
